- Initial Hotline Booking – Provide your postcode, vehicle/tyre size, and location.
- Technician Dispatch – Typically within 30–60 minutes.
- On-site Puncture Assessment – If repairable (within safe zone), they plug or patch from inside; otherwise replacement.
- Tyre Replacement & Balancing – Tech carries a range of tyres; wheel balancing is done with mobile balancing units.
- Optional Additional Services – Locking wheel nut removal, TPMS check, tyre pressure check, and advice.

- Wheel alignment usually cannot be done on-site; mobile balancing may be less precise than garage machines.
- Some mobile fitters may supply part-worn or budget tyres without full disclosure—ask for the specific brand and age.
